I have a 2006 GTI 4 tec and runs smooth and fine cold but after warm up goes to running rough and oil smoke and the low oil pressure sensor flashes. Put in a new sensor, plugs and coils. No change
 
If there's too much crankcase oil pr possibly the wrong type it could tend to expel and enter the intake manifold from up through the crankcase breather. Not sure this would also relate to oil pressure warning unless the oil is being airated, in which case you might notice air bubbles in the oil on the dipstick when you check it immediately upon the fault occurrence.
 
I run the seadoo semi synthetic oil and it's between the 2 marks on the stick. Didn't check for bubble but the thing has to run for about 5 minutes before it starts acting up . I'll check the intake breather.
 
That seems to be the correct level. Sure sounds like you're getting oil into the intake from through the crankcase ventilation breather (Like a PCV system can puke oil into the intake). If the oil is airating (air is churned into the oil) by a high level the combination of air and oil emulsion will make the oil level too high and oil mixed with air doesn't pump well thus oil pressure will be low.
